Late to the party, but suggestions:
I'm a long time football sim player, and I'm currently playing PFS, which is a very good game in and of itself. These are some suggestions that I have made to the developer about things that PFS does NOT currently have but probably should, so some of these may be in the plan already, so take them for what they are. Enjoy.
1) In Game "Mass Updates" for everything- Age, size, height, weight, contract lengths, etc. Also you should be able to update by position, age, or even team; IE: Every player on the New Orleans Saints gets a +2 to strength or whatever. 2) Player Rotation- You should be able to set players to rotate- IE: I wanna play this D-Lineman on 3rd and long, I wanna play this RB when the starter's energy is at 70%, or I wanna play this OT when we're up by 28 points or more 3) Defensive "Coverages"- You should be able to put your defense in "coverages", not just formations- IE, We're in 4-3, yea, but are we in man to man, cover 2, cover 3, prevent, etc? I have some more ideas about this, but I'll keep em to myself for now. 4) The option to go for 2- We should be able to go for 2 any time we want. Or never. Or anything in between. 5) Onside kicks- Same thing as going for 2. Any time. Never. Sometimes. Whatever. 6) Guided Training- Right now in PFS the training system is so ridiculously random, your offensive linemen have as good a chance to get better at kick accuracy as they do at run blocking. Please have a reasonable training system. 7) Guided blitzes- You should be able to pick who you want blitzing. I *never* want my middle backer with 68 speed blitzing. I *always* want my strong safety with 92 speed blitzing. Probably a lot more stuff to suggest, but I know nothing of BTS yet, so I'll just rest on that stuff for now ![]() Like I said, these are all things I've suggested to the developer of PFS and have never heard so much as a "Screw you" about them. Maybe he'll do em, maybe he wont, but I'd sure love to play a game that DID have those things. |

Very quickly:
1)No. You can edit players individually though (I worked on the editor today in fact!) 2)Yes, not sure how to what extent it will be though. 3)Yep, already in 4)You choose the plays, up to you if you go for 2 or not. 5)see above 6)Obviously DL won't train at kicking. 7)You call the plays, so you decide who blitzes. It's a bit more involved than "he has 78 speed so choose him" though. |

Yes, you'll be able to create strategies, like in OOTP, and your coaching staff will have certain tendencies, so you can hire and fire the coaches you want to fit your style of play (a grinding ground game vs. an aerial attack, a defense that blitzes a lot vs. one that's more conservative, etc.).
Francis may have an idea at this point how granular the strategy settings will be, such as "Run 90% of the time on 1st and 10 in the first quarter, when the score is tied or I'm ahead, or behind by no more than 10 points." That would work like OOTP's drop downs, I assume, but don't quote me - Francis will have the last word there. ![]() |
